WebFeb 5, 2024 · The simple answer is: It depends on the pool. First, to cover a mile, you’ll have to swim 5,280 feet, or 1,760 yards, or 1,609.34 meters. Second, not every pool is the same length. Far from it. Imperial Measurement In the United States, pools intended for training or competition are typically measured in either yards or meters. WebMay 30, 2024 · In a 25-meter pool, 1 mile is 64.4 laps and in a 50-meter pool, 1 mile is 32.2 laps. Similarly, the number of laps you will need to swim to complete a swimmer’s mile will also be dependent on pool length. In a 25 yard pool, you’ll have to swim 66 laps. WebJan 14, 2024 · When it comes to distance swimming, the 1650-yard freestyle race (which is 66 lengths, or 33 laps, in a 25-yard pool) is sometimes referred to as “the mile.” While technically a complete mile, the race falls 110 yards (or 6.25 percent) shy of being a true mile.
